Overall Meaning

In KJ-52's song Outro, the artist uses a comedic approach to express his frustration with fast food restaurants. The song begins with the artist calling a fast-food restaurant and attempting to order a coke, fry, and cheeseburger. However, the employee on the other end is continuously misunderstanding or mishearing the order, leading to a humorous, heated conversation. The artist then drives to the restaurant, where he continues to struggle with getting what he ordered.


Through this sarcastic and humorous approach, KJ-52 highlights the issues that come with fast food establishments, ranging from ineffective customer service to missing or incorrect orders.


Overall, Outro serves as a commentary on the struggles that many individuals face when attempting to order fast food, showcasing the humorous side of frustration.
